  • NIKKISO HYDROGARD Back Pressure Valve


    Features:

  • Broad range of valve body materials.
  • Long life PTFE or FKM diaphragms.
  • Chatter-proof design eliminates vibration
         and extends valve life.
  • Field adjustable for changing process
         conditions.
  • Field serviceable without special tools.




    HydroGarD Application Notes:
    1.   HydroGarD back pressure valves are field adjustable.
    2.   The minimum recommended set pressure for the
          HydroGarD back pressure valve is 25 psig.






  • Discharge pressures that fall below inlet pressure can cause flow to siphon through the pump. NIKKISO's HydroGarD valves offer a simple solution to this problem. HydroGarD back pressure valves enhance the performance of pumps by providing a constant, reciprocating discharge or back pressure - particularly in artificial applications where suction pressures are greater than discharge pressure. These spring-loaded, diaphragm-type valves can also function as anti- siphon valve. They are designed for easy, low cost installation and on-line maintenance. And all are factory tested prior to shipment, with settings that can be easily adjusted in the field.

    HydroGarD valves are built for reliable, dependable performance, Inert PTFE or FKM diaphragms protect internal components from damage by process fluids. And parts that come in contact with fluid are of materials chosen for their corrosion-resistance in each application. There's also a special plugged port at the bottom of the valve body for easy bleeding, sampling or pressure gauge installation.

       Recommended Installation

       Safety relief valve must discharge to atmospheric pressure. Use of a pulsation dampener in combination
       with a back pressure valve will result in longer valve life, by eliminating cycling with each pump stroke.
